Smart meters are advanced digital devices designed to measure and record electricity, gas, or water consumption while enabling automated communication with utility providers. These devices transmit consumption data in real time through communication networks, allowing utilities to monitor resource usage more efficiently than traditional meter systems.
The adoption of smart metering technologies has increased significantly as utility providers modernize infrastructure and implement digital monitoring solutions. Smart meters enable accurate billing, improve operational efficiency, and provide consumers with greater visibility into their resource consumption. As global energy systems evolve toward digital management and smart grid technologies, smart meters are becoming essential components in modern energy distribution networks.

Technological Innovations Transforming the Market
One of the key recent developments in the Smart Meter Market is the integration of Internet of Things (IoT) technologies into smart metering systems. IoT-enabled smart meters allow utilities to transmit consumption data in real time through secure communication networks.
These devices support remote monitoring and automated data collection, reducing the need for manual meter readings and improving operational efficiency. Utilities can analyze consumption data to identify usage trends and optimize energy distribution networks.
Advanced analytics platforms integrated with smart metering systems also enable predictive maintenance and improved grid management. These technologies allow utilities to detect faults early and respond quickly to potential service disruptions.
Expansion of Smart Grid Infrastructure
The expansion of smart grid infrastructure is another major development influencing the Smart Meter Market. Governments and utility providers are investing in digital energy networks that enable real-time monitoring and control of electricity distribution systems.
Smart meters serve as critical components of smart grid systems by providing accurate data on electricity consumption and grid performance. This data helps utilities implement demand response programs, balance energy supply and demand, and improve grid reliability.
As smart grid projects expand globally, the demand for advanced smart metering solutions continues to increase.
Adoption Across Emerging Energy Applications
Recent developments in the Smart Meter Market also include growing adoption across emerging energy applications. Renewable energy systems such as solar and wind power are increasingly being integrated into electricity grids, creating new challenges for energy distribution.
Smart meters help utilities monitor energy flows from renewable sources and maintain stable grid operations. These devices provide real-time data that allows utilities to manage distributed energy resources more effectively.
In addition, smart meters are being integrated into smart city infrastructure projects aimed at improving urban resource management. Smart cities rely on digital technologies to monitor electricity, water, and gas consumption, making smart metering systems essential for efficient infrastructure management.
